Table 1.
Example theoretical maximum AR (ARmax) and estimated optimality from values reported in literature, including necessary information needed to perform calculation.
| Source | Ligand | Switch direction | (μM) | ARexp | Source of ARexp estimate | [I] at ARmax(μM) | Optimality: ARexp/ARmax | |
|---|---|---|---|---|---|---|---|---|
| Tang and Breaker (1997b) | ATP | OFF | 10a | 180 | Ribozyme cleavage products on gel | 1000 | 101 | 1.78 |
| Soukup and Breaker (1999a) | FMN | ON | 0.5b | 33 | Ribozyme cleavage products on gel | 20 | 40 | 0.83 |
| Suess et al. (2004) | Theophylline | OFF | 0.3c | 8 | Beta-galactosidase activity in B. subtilis | 6000 | 17,650 | 0.0005 |
| Wieland, Benz, Klauser, and Hartig (2009) | TPP | ON | 0.32d | 7.5 | GFP fluorescence in E. coli | 100 | 313 | 0.02 |
| Kellenberger et al. (2013) | c-AMP-GMP | ON | 4.2e | 6.4 | Spinach-DFHBI fluorescence in E. coli | 100 | 25 | 0.26 |
